Effect of seed priming on growth parameters and yield of lentil (Lens culinaris Medic.)
Abstract
An experiment was conducted to study the “Effect of seed priming on growth and yield of lentil (Lens culinaris Medic.) at New Dairy Farm, Kalyanpur, during Rabi season of 2016-17 & 2017-18 on lentil variety KLS-218. The experiment was comprised ten seed priming treatments viz., T0- Control, T1- Seed priming with Trichoderma harzianum @ 1.5%, T2- Seed priming with GA3 @ 50ppm, T3- Seed priming with Vitavax power @ 0.25%, T4 - Seed priming with GA3 @ 50ppm + seed coating with Trichoderma harzianum @ 15g/kg seed, T5- Seed treatment with Bavistin @ 3g/kg seed, T6- Seed priming with sodium molybdate @ 500 ppm, T7- Seed priming with sodium molybdate @ 500ppm + seed coating with Trichoderma harzianum @ 15 g/kg, T8- Seed priming with water, T9- Seed priming with leaf extract of Lantana camara @ 10% .The present investigation revealed that seed priming with sodium molybdate @ 500 ppm + seed coating with T. harzianum @ 15g/ kg seed was significantly highest to improved the growth and seed yield parameters over unprimed (control) with highest field emergence (93.66%), number of plants per square meter (237.66), number of pods per plant (137.49), number of seeds per pod (1.81), seed yield per plot (1.22 Kg) & seed yield (12.20 q/ha). Treatment T7 was the best priming treatment as it showed highest benefit cost ratio (1:2.49) which increase growth, yield and seed quality parameters and enhance to the farmer’s income. T1 (seed priming with Trichoderma harzianum @ 1.5%) was found second best priming treatment.
